There is also a standard Force Organisation chart. (for most Scenarios, and events such as tournies.) Your minimum is 1 HQ, and 2 troop choices, then from there you can take one more HQ choice(total 2), and 4 more troop choices(total 6) Then up to 3 fast attack, 3 heavy support, and 3 Elites.

The commander and command squad only count as one HQ selection if you puchased them to accompany the commander. There is a section at the bottom of Commander army listing that says that your commander/leader may be accompanied by a command squad adn only count as one HQ choice in the force organization chart.

Otherwise, the only thing you have to worry about are the 5 Heavy Support choices. The most you are allowed to have in one army/force organization chart is usually 3.
